Genghis Khan, the founder of the Mongol Empire, is renowned for uniting the Mongolian tribes and establishing one of the largest contiguous empires in history. He implemented innovative military strategies, including the use of highly mobile cavalry and psychological warfare, which enabled him to conquer vast territories across Asia and Europe. Additionally, he promoted trade and communication along the Silk Road, facilitating cultural exchange and the spread of ideas. His legal code, the Yassa, helped to establish order and governance within the diverse populations of his empire.

No, Tamerlane (Temur Lang, meaning Temur the Lame) lived several generations later than Genghis Kahn. Genghis Kahn died in 1227, Temur in 1405. Genghis Kahn was a Mongol, born in Mongolia, while Temur was a Turk (quite possibly with some Mongol blood), from the area that is now Uzbekistan. He made Samarkand his capital. His empire was neither as large nor as enduring as that of Genghis Kahn.
